Abstract

An apparatus for assembling a bicycle frame of the type in which the head tube, bottom bracket and seat post bracket include stubs for receiving connecting tubes in a press fit. The apparatus includes a base, a clamp for receiving the bottom bracket, a carriage for receiving the head tube, and a swing arm which pivots about the axis of the bottom bracket clamp and receives the seat post bracket and seat mast of the bicycle frame. Double-acting cylinder motors are mounted on the base for displacing the carriage toward the bottom bracket clamp and for pivoting the swing arm toward the carriage. Other cylinder motors are mounted on the carriage and are actuated to secure the head tube, and a cylinder motor is mounted on the swing arm to urge the seat bracket toward the bottom bracket. A computer control selectively actuates the cylinders to urge the bottom bracket, seat post bracket, and head tube toward each other in a substantially continuous motion, thereby urging their respective stubs into the ends of the connecting tubes to form the bicycle frame.
